(ANSA) - MOSCOW, NOVEMBER 15 - The resolution approved yesterday by the UN General Assembly, according to which Russia must compensate Ukraine for the damage caused in the invasion ordered by Putin, was criticized by the Kremlin, which defined it " the formalization of a theft".

This was reported by the Interfax agency.


    "Naturally - Putin's spokesman Dmitri Peskov said - the organizers of this process are trying to complete the theft of our reserves abroad, which have been blocked in an absolutely illegal way. In reality, (this is) the formalization of a theft through the United Nations platform".
